Construction activity in 2024 was down 75% from the prior year, with 1 housing unit permitted.

  • •98% fewer units than the average Portage County town (42), suggesting slower-than-typical growth.
  • •Average unit valued at $550K — 41% above the Portage County average of $390K, indicating higher-end construction.
  • •All permits were for single-family homes — no multi-family construction.
